Abuja — The Guild of Online Media Editors and Publishers of Nigeria (GOMEP-NG) has pledged to deepen collaboration with the Federal Government in advancing responsible journalism and national development, while commending President Bola Ahmed Tinubu for what it described as his bold leadership and far-reaching economic reform agenda.

The commitment was made during a courtesy visit by a GOMEP-NG delegation, led by its National President, Comrade Otiti Akpovoke, to the Presidency in Abuja.

Receiving the delegation on behalf of President Tinubu, Mohammed Idris conveyed the President’s appreciation for the visit and reaffirmed the Federal Government’s commitment to maintaining a productive partnership with online media organisations in promoting responsible journalism, national development and effective public enlightenment.

Speaking during the visit, Akpovoke commended President Tinubu for reengineering the nation’s economic architecture, noting that while the reforms may require time before their full benefits are realised, they reflect courageous leadership and a clear commitment to repositioning Nigeria’s economy.

He said GOMEP-NG envisions a structured and sustainable partnership with the Federal Government to strengthen strategic communication, improve timely dissemination of government policies and programmes, and promote credible online journalism.

According to him, the Guild remains committed to complementing the efforts of the Federal Government through professional and responsible digital media practice, adding that the proposed collaboration would also serve as an empowerment initiative for online media practitioners by creating opportunities for capacity development, professional growth and greater inclusion of qualified practitioners within the digital media ecosystem.

A major highlight of the visit was the presentation of GOMEP-NG’s strategic partnership proposal to the Presidency, alongside the conferment of the Guild’s Excellence Awards on President Bola Ahmed Tinubu and the Minister of Information and National Orientation, Mohammed Idris, in recognition of their contributions to governance and public communication.
